Because I better should not roll out QGIS with the afore mentioned premanent 
ballpark-warning in place, I investigatetd further and stumbled across an 
"allowFallback"-setting:

By placing a default datum transformation in the settings/options.../CRS you 
get new entries in your QGIS3.ini [find it on win at %APPDATA%\QGIS\QGIS3\], 
which are the operation parameters themselve and a setting to allow the 
approximate “ballpark” transformation [...] between a source and destination 
CRS pair, in the case that the preferred coordinate operation fails".

[Projections]
EPSG%3A31467\EPSG%3A25832_allowFallback=true
EPSG%3A31467\EPSG%3A25832_coordinateOp="+proj=pipeline +step +inv +proj=tmerc 
+lat_0=0 +lon_0=9 +k=1 +x_0=3500000 +y_0=0 +ellps=bessel +step +proj=hgridshift 
+grids=Minden.gsb +step +proj=utm +zone=32 +ellps=GRS80"

This is also writen to any project file containing layers with the crs', 
covered by the default datum transformation. It appears within in the tag 
<transformContext><srcDest [...] allowFallback="1"> and causes the warning to 
show up every time this project will be loaded, although the datum 
transformation is already working an no fallback seems necessary. 

If the _allowFallback=-setting in QGIS3.ini is (manually) edited to 'false', 
newly saved project files also contain <srcDest [...] allowFallback="0"> and 
the warning will not be displayed again on project load.

Reference to my quite hacky findings can be found in the QGIS Python API Doc, 
search for 'allowFallback': 
https://qgis.org/pyqgis/3.10/search.html?q=allowFallback
Some of the allowFallback stuff is labeled "New in version 3.12", however I 
currently investigate on 3.10.5-LTR. Might this indicate a backporting issue? 
(Otherwise, the implementation of my datum transformation very well might still 
be incomplete, don't know.)

> > > Is it correct, that the tranformations in this dialog are read from
> > > \share\proj\proj.db and therefore this is the place to add my
> > > configuration?
> > Yes
> > > I found that there is a record for the (not shipped)
> > > BWTA2017.gsb. in table grid_transformation of proj.db. So, do I just have
> > > to add a record to grid_transformation for my gridfile in the same way?
> > Yes
> > > What would be the correct parameters? Is there another table that has to 
> > > be
> > > adapted to make it work?
> > The critical parameters to set are the EPSG code of the source and target 
> > CRS. You must use the geographic CRS ones that correspond to the projected 
> > one you mentions. So EPSG:4314 (DHDN) as the source and EPSG:4258 (ETRS89) 
> > as the target. Starting from the record for BWTA2017 should be a good idea.
> > For the area of use, you may want to look at the "area" table for a code 
> > that fits the bounding box of the grid, or create a new one if there is no 
> > match
> > For the auth_name of the transformation use 'PROJ', and for the code give 
> > some name like 'EPSG_4314_TO_EPSG_4258_FOR_AREA_XXXX'
> > Utimately, if this grid is open data matching the criteria mentioned at 
> > https://github.com/OSGeo/PROJ-data, you may want to submit for inclusion 
> > here *and* also make sure the grid is registered in the EPSG database by 
> > contacting IOGP:
> > http://www.epsg.org/EPSGDataset/Makechangerequest.aspx
> > Once donce, that would avoid you in the future to have to hack the PROJ 
> > database.
> > Note: there are a number of other grids for Germany listed at
> > https://github.com/OSGeo/proj-datumgrid/issues that would be candidates for 
> > such a process.
